Best Time to Visit Pisco
Pisco sits on Peru's dry southern coast, so its weather barely changes: warm, sunny days and cool nights year-round. The real variables are tourist crowds, which peak during Peruvian summer holidays, and the occasional coastal fog (garúa) in winter.
✦ Go in April or May for the best balance of sunny weather, manageable crowds, and affordable rates.
✅ Best months
April and May—clear skies, fewer crowds, and comfortable temperatures around 22–26°C. October is also excellent, with spring wildflowers and calm seas for boat trips to the Ballestas Islands.
🔥 Peak season
January and February: Peruvian summer break fills hotels, especially around the Fiesta de la Vendimia (grape harvest) in March. Room rates can double. Expect busy beaches and packed tours.
💷 Shoulder (best value)
March and November: March still has good weather but crowds thin after Vendimia. November sees spring warmth and lower prices before the December rush.
🌙 Quietest & cheapest
June through August: coolest months (18–22°C) with grey mornings from garúa. Hotels drop rates by 30-40%. Trade-off: choppier seas for island tours.

🎭 Events worth timing a trip around
Fiesta de la Vendimia (grape harvest festival) in early March—wine tastings, parades, and the crowning of the harvest queen. Also the International Pisco Sour Day in late February (city-wide cocktail celebrations).
🧳 What to pack
Bring a windproof jacket or fleece even in summer—the evening breeze off the Pacific can chill you quickly, especially on boats.
